Message type: E = Error
Message class: /SAPAPO/DC_MSG -
Message number: 230
Message text: Characteristic group &1 presently being edited by user &2

- Characteristic group &1 presently being edited by user &2 ?The SAP error message
/SAPAPO/DC_MSG230
indicates that a characteristic group is currently being edited by another user. This is a common issue in SAP systems, particularly in the context of Advanced Planning and Optimization (APO) where multiple users may be working on the same data simultaneously.Cause:

To resolve this issue, you can take the following steps:
Identify the User: Check who is currently editing the characteristic group. The error message provides the user ID of the person who has the lock.
Contact the User: If possible, reach out to the user who is editing the characteristic group and ask them to finish their work or release the lock.
Wait for Release: If the user is actively working on the characteristic group, you may need to wait until they complete their changes and save or exit the transaction.
Check for Background Jobs: Sometimes, background jobs or processes may hold locks on characteristic groups. Check if there are any running jobs that might be causing the lock.
Use Transaction SM12: If you believe the lock is no longer valid (for example, if the user has logged off unexpectedly), you can use transaction SM12
to view and delete the lock entries. However, be cautious when doing this, as it may lead to data inconsistencies if the user is still working on the data.
Review System Settings: If this issue occurs frequently, consider reviewing the system settings related to locking mechanisms and user access to ensure they align with your organization's needs.
